FlexPaper 显示不出来
使用的springMVC 在页面上上传文件 上传完成action跳转到jsp页面并取得了显示的swf文件的路径 然后使用FlexPaper显示 却显示不出来 直接是白的 (FlexPaper的FlexPaperViewer.swf 都没有显示) 但是我已经放在同一目录下了 直接写死路径 就可以显示出来 这是什么原因啊
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(16)
再补一下 Content/FlexPaper_145_flash/FlexPaperViewer 路径改一下即可
var fp = new FlexPaperViewer(
'Content/FlexPaper_145_flash/FlexPaperViewer',
'viewerPlaceHolder', { config: {
SwfFile: escape('Content/FlexPaper_145_flash/Paper.swf'),
我找到原因了, 我今天也遇到这种情况,耽误了我起码30分钟以上。是因为flexpaper_flash.js里面有代码写死了,expressInstall: "js/expressinstall.swf" ,里面的代码是写死的路径,所以你的页面必须和js同级目录才行。
解决办法:1:修改flexpaper_flash.js,把路径作为参数传进来,2:就把显示页面放在这个目录下,利用框架页加载这个页面
空白的原因 也就那集中 路径不对 插件没有加载 其他的应该不会有什么问题
这个我也不是很清楚 好久都没搞了
楼主问题解决了没有 我在thinkphp中通过Action之后就显示不出来了 写文件所在绝对路径就能展示 求解
回复
页面刚加载的时候闪过一条进度条,然后就空白。我本来也以为是插件没有加载,但是看了用户ie,确实有Flash插件。现在只能上级一下插件试试看了。
目前我在客户的机器上,chrome 浏览器可以显示,但是ie下就一篇空白。不知道这个是什么原因?
这个 你得去看看 路径 一般的话 都是路径的问题 显示不出来的
我这也显示不出来,不过我是用asp.net做的。只能在默认的action下显示,如果做到其他action就显示不出来了。。相当的郁闷啊。。
不是吧 啥情况啊 不应该的啊 下载到本地之后 哪怕打不开swf 但也不至于连框框都不显示吧
难打是ie9的原因,在另外一部机上就可以了。。。
回复
我就显示了个框,不能显示绝对路径下的文件
怎么没找到?我的也是遇到同样的问题,求解
我也遇到 这个.swf 404 错误 我也是放webRoot目录下的啊
在浏览器是可以找到,可是就是显示空白?
把你的要显示的swf文件url 地址直接放浏览器地址栏,看看浏览器能不能找到。